I applied online. I interviewed at Baker McKenzie (Belfast, Northern Ireland) in Jan 2015
Interview
Tough, prepare to the know the industry and sectors well. interviewers were friendly and not intimidating but asked hard hitting questions. Know your CV inside out! Know about the company, cases and deals they recently worked on.
I interviewed at Baker McKenzie (Belfast, Northern Ireland)
Interview
Application involving motivational essay question as to why you would want to work at Baker McKenzie. Followed by an in-person interview including competency, situational and basic commercial awareness questions. There was also a 10 min presentation on a given topic.
The interview consisted of a short pre-prepared presentation followed by a longer competency based interview. After the interview, the feedback was very quick and I received an offer through telephone call.

I interviewed at Baker McKenzie (Belfast, Northern Ireland)
Interview
Short presentation on a case followed by a 30 minute competency based interview. Not too many questions and they were not Very difficult to answer. Talk through your CV. Very relaxed and informal. Felt natural
